Construction looks set to begin on the Meygen tidal energy Project off the coast of Caithness in Scotland next month after conditions were finalised in order to initiate the first drawdown from financiers (Crown Estate and Scottish Enterprise).

The project has been worked on since 2007 when Stakeholder Engagement began. Environmental Studies commenced in 2009 with an Environmental Impact Assessment for phase 1 of the development completed in 2011. The project secured 253MW of grid capacity in 2012 and submitted applications to Marine Scotland and the Highland Council.

Once completed, the tidal energy project will have a capacity of almost 400MW with the first power being generated in 2016.
